A Quiet Kind of Renewal
Renewal does not always arrive as a transformation. Sometimes, it feels like a soft return to yourself.
There is something about this time of year that quietly invites reflection. Not in a loud or demanding way, but in a subtle shift you can feel if you slow down enough to notice it.
We often associate renewal with big changes. New goals, new versions of ourselves, new beginnings that feel visible and defined. But real renewal is often much quieter than that.
It can look like resting without guilt. Letting go of something you have outgrown. Choosing softness where you used to choose pressure. It is less about becoming someone new, and more about returning to what already feels true.
“Renewal begins the moment you stop forcing and start allowing.”
Letting Things Be Gentle
Not everything has to be intense to be meaningful. Growth does not always come from pushing harder. Sometimes it comes from creating space, from breathing, from allowing yourself to exist without constant expectation.
A Softer Way to Begin Again
You don’t need a perfect plan to begin again. You don’t need to have everything figured out. A new beginning can be as simple as choosing to meet yourself with more kindness today than you did yesterday.
